Remington ends Cardinals’ season

Body
TSnews The Conway Springs Cardinals girls basketball team fell behind early against the Remington Broncos and never could recover in a 47-28 loss to the Broncos last Wednesday in the Class 2A substate semifinals at Conway Springs. Remington led 13-5 after the opening period and 15-7 at the intermission, then used a strong third period to take a 31-19 lead to the fourth quarter.

Andale denies Clearwater in substate final

Body
TSnews The Clearwater Indians girls basketball team got off to a solid start but could not sustain that momentum in a 48-33 loss at Andale in the Class 4A West substate finals last Saturday. The Indians (13-9) led 10-9 after the opening period, but the hosts rallied and led 18-14 at the intermission.
Camryn Carlson defends an Andale player during the second quarter of Saturday’s road game. Clearwater trailed by just 4 points at halftime, but saw Andale pull away in the second half. Travis Mounts/TSnews

Cardinals hold off tough GP team in semifinal

Body
TSnews With the Garden Pain Owls facing second-half foul trouble, the Cheney Cardinals were able to pull away in last week’s substate semifinal in Cheney to win 64-46. The teams battled hard throughout an intense, physical first half that featured six lead changes and six ties.

Cards avenge loss, punch ticket to State

Body
TSnews The Cheney Cardinals boys basketball team is headed back to State, thanks to their 45-39 victory over the Haven Wildcats in Saturday’s substate championship, which was played in front of a standing-room only crowd at Halstead High School. Cheney will open up Class 3A State play in Thursday’s late game at the Hutchinson Sports Arena.
Jase Robertson makes a 3-point basket during Cheney’s win over Haven on Saturday. The Cardinals earned a return trip to the Class 3A State tournament in Hutchinson starting on Thursday. Andrea McDaniel/TSnews

Ashland ends Raiders’ season

Body
TSnews The Argonia Raiders boys basketball team could not overcome an early deficit in its Class 1A Division II substate opener last Tuesday and lost 44-39 at Ashland. The Raiders ended their season with a record of 7-15.

Friday win puts Colts into substate

Body
TSnews A win by the Campus boys basketball team has advanced the Colts into this week’s Class 6A substate tournament. The Colts beat the Salina Central Mustangs 56-55 last Friday in Haysville.
